{"data":{"id":"us-sd/sdcl-16-2-29.5","jurisdiction":"us-sd","citation":"SDCL § 16-2-29.5","heading":"Records search fee.","body":"The clerk of court shall charge a records search fee in the amount of twenty dollars for each record search conducted if the search is requested by a person who is not a party named in the action for which the search is being requested. The clerk shall charge a fee of five dollars if the requesting party certifies that the search is being requested in conjunction with a pending state or federal cause of action. A separate fee shall be charged for each name, whether individual or corporate, for which a search is requested. The clerk shall deposit the fee in accordance with § 16-2-43. The clerk may not charge a records search fee if the search is requested by an attorney of record or any member of the attorney of record's law firm or staff.","path":["TITLE 16.
